For sale: a Rare and Exceptional first hardcover edition, first printing of The Talisman by Stephen King and Peter Straub in a new archival wrap.
The book is in Near Fine condition with clean, bright boards, strong title gilt and black ink on a straight spine, lightly foxed page blocks, tight binding, no spine tilt, lightly rolled spine ends, mild edge wear, and two lightly bumped corners. The interior of the book is also in Near Fine condition with no marks, inscriptions or other signs of ownership inside. The end papers and the interior pages are clean and bright, making it an excellent addition to any collection.
The dust jacket is in Very Good condition with $18.95 price on the front flap, mild surface wear, two tape repairs and heavy edge wear. Looks great in a new Brodart archival wrap.
